Abstract

The invention relates to a control system and a control method for electronic parking of an automatic transmission automobile. The control system comprises a circuit board with a singlechip, wherein the circuit board is provided with a tilt sensor, a GPS (Global Positioning System) module, an OBD (omnibearing-distance system ) signal input terminal, a brake lamp connector, and a gear sensor for obtaining gear signals, or the OBD signal input terminal used for obtaining gear signals directly; an electronic parking button pressing and pulling switch and an electronic parking auto key are arranged inside a driving room; the circuit board is connected to a motor power supply box and can be used for controlling the forward or reverse rotation; and the circuit board is connected to the motor through a Hall sensor so as to obtain rotational speed signals. The system and the method have the benefits as follows: firstly, by additionally adding the GPS module, the speed per hour of a vehicle is determined in an auxiliary manner so as to achieve a safer using effect; and secondly, later period modification of most vehicles are available through the adoption of the method and the system, through the improvement on the parking system of a conventional vehicle, the performance of the conventional automobile can be effectively enhanced, and vehicle accidents caused by forgetting to pull a hand brake or hand brake fault are reduced.

Technical field
The present invention relates to a kind of automobile parking control system, particularly a kind of automatic catch automobile electronics parking control system and control method.
Background technology
The orthodox car Parking Brake is finished Parking by M/C, along with the propelling of urban construction process, traffic lights are more and more in the city, wait red time and number of times more and more, all need the people is pull-up and relieving Parking Brake at every turn, and this has increased people's steering vehicle work capacity.Behind automobile flameout, a lot of chaufeurs are forgotten the pull-up parking brake, have caused the generation of accident in addition.Existing electronics parking system is loaded down with trivial details, is difficult for promoting the use of in common vehicle, has influenced the popularity that electronics Parking technology is used.
Summary of the invention
Purpose of the present invention is exactly the above-mentioned defective that exists at prior art, and a kind of automatic catch automobile electronics parking control system and control method are provided.
A kind of automatic catch automobile electronics parking control system includes the circuit card (t) of micro controller system (s), and circuit card (t) is provided with obliquity sensor (j), to detect the fore-and-aft tilt angle of vehicle; Circuit card (t) is provided with GPS module (k), with the moving velocity of auxiliary detection vehicle; The input end of circuit card is connected to the OBD signal input part (b) of vehicle, obtains the speed per hour of vehicle, engine rotational speed signal, switch signal from OBD signal input part (b); Brake signal interface from wire harness of vehicle brake sensor connection to circuit card is (v), to obtain brake signal; Gear position sensor (c) is installed in the speed-changing mechanism relevant position or is directly obtained gear signal by OBD signal input part (b); Vehicle drive is indoor to arrange an electronics Parking by drag switch (d), and this electronics Parking is pressed drag switch (d) and is the press-pull type structure; Be sidelong by one of drag switch (d) in the electronics Parking and put an electronics Parking automatic key (e); Circuit card (t) is connected to the motor power case by motor power interface (o), can control the motor forward, contrarotation; Circuit card (t) is connected to motor by Hall element (p), to obtain tach signal; At a circuit card welding phonetic alarm (i); Be provided with motor initial position adjusting key (f) at circuit card.
Connect relay at circuit card (t), link to each other with stoplight stop lamp with former car parking lamp, so that during Parking, parking lamp and stoplight stop lamp are lighted.
Pin-saving chip (u) is set, to realize that the mode of operation of electronics Parking is carried out record on the circuit card (t).
Be provided with a data interface (n) at circuit card (t), to realize the change to SCM program, download the working data of electronics Parking simultaneously.
Described motor initial position adjusting key (f) with increase key (g), dwindle key (h), red light (l), green light (m) be used, and adjusts the motor initial position.
The control method of a kind of automatic catch automobile electronics Parking that the present invention mentions comprises that following method realizes:
A: when the Parking motor is sensed following arbitrary condition and is satisfied, the backguy of Parking motor tension Parking Brake:
1) when the OBD induction of signal to the speed of a motor vehicle during at low speed, and the GPS module senses vehicle speed when middle low speed, in addition, after sensing vehicle electrical gate signal (a) and closing, the Parking motor is strained the Parking Brake backguy automatically;
2) when the OBD induction of signal to the speed of a motor vehicle during at low speed, and the GPS module be can not confirm Vehicle Speed the time, in addition, after sensing vehicle electrical gate signal (a) and closing, the Parking motor is strained the Parking Brake backguy automatically;
3) when the OBD induction of signal is low speed to the speed of a motor vehicle, and the GPS module senses vehicle speed when middle low speed, in addition, be pulled upwardly the parking brake switch after, the Parking motor is strained the Parking Brake backguy automatically;
4) when the OBD induction of signal is low speed to the speed of a motor vehicle, and the GPS module be can not confirm Vehicle Speed the time, in addition, be pulled upwardly the parking brake switch after, the Parking motor is strained the Parking Brake backguy automatically;
5) when the OBD induction of signal is low speed to the speed of a motor vehicle, and the GPS module is sensed vehicle speed when middle low speed, in addition, after the electronics Parking automatic key (e) of vehicle starts, when getting access to brake signal, sense vehicle and hang into P shelves or N shelves, the Parking motor is strained the Parking Brake backguy automatically;
6) when the OBD induction of signal is low speed to the speed of a motor vehicle, and when the GPS module can not be confirmed Vehicle Speed, in addition, after the electronics Parking automatic key (e) of vehicle starts, when getting access to brake signal, sense vehicle and hang into P shelves or N shelves, the Parking motor is strained the Parking Brake backguy automatically;
B: the Parking motor loosens satisfied condition:
1) the Parking motor tightens up, when press downwards the electronics Parking by drag switch (d) after, the Parking motor loosens automatically;
2) the Parking motor tightens up, and when electronics Parking automatic key (e) started, circuit card was sensed gear not behind P shelves or N shelves, and the Parking motor unclamps automatically;
C: the affirmation of Parking motor pulling force:
The obliquity sensor sense vehicle is parked the gradient, and the variation that the operating voltage of Parking motor is parked angle with vehicle changes, when the gradient hour, give motor with less operating voltage, when motor during near locked rotor current, the Parking motor quits work; When the gradient is big, give motor with big operating voltage, when motor during near locked rotor current, the Parking motor quits work;
D: motor Hall element effect
When the Parking motor is strained, the number of turns of changeing when Hall element is sensed motor operations, when the Parking motor unclamps, the number of turns that control circuit the time changes according to tension, the corresponding number of turns of reversing sense work automatically.
In above-mentioned control method, set up phonetic alarm (i):
1) when the flame-out Parking of vehicle, obliquity sensor is sensed the gradient when big, and the Parking motor is strained simultaneously automatically, voice suggestion " the parking gradient is bigger, please hang and enter car stop ";
2) system has self-checking function, after detecting the Parking motor and surpassing the maximum functional distance, and then prompting " electronics Parking mechanical breakdown is please repaired as early as possible ";
Whether 3) system also detects other connection lines fault, as the electric switch signal fault, the OBD signal fault, brake signal fault, and other faults of circuit inside, if any fault, voice suggestion corresponding site fault then is after having checked, after the system restart, after System self-test is normal, the voice suggestion cancellation;
4) be in tension when the Parking motor, and speed per hour greater than 5 kms/hour after, automatic speech prompting is decontroled Parking Brake.
Above-mentioned low speed refers to: 2 kms/hour below, described in low speed refer to: 10 kms/hour below, certainly, can be at the velocity amplitude of different automobile types by the control employed low speed of software set different automobile types and middle low speed.
The invention has the beneficial effects as follows: the one, the present invention assists by increase GPS module the speed per hour of vehicle is measured, to reach safest result of use; The 2nd, the present invention is applicable to the later stage repacking of most vehicles, improves by the electronics parking system to existing low and middle-end vehicle, can effectively solve the performance boost of existing automobile, reduces owing to forget and pull the hand brake or vehicle safety accident that the parking brake fault causes.
